1. (Almost) flawless skin
With saying flawless skin, I’m not giving you the cue to apply a butt load of foundation on your face. Instead, try to take good care of your skin. Because trust me, when your skins condition is at its best, your make-up will apply a lot nicer too! So after cleansing and moisturizing your skin, apply a light foundation/tinted moisturizer all over your face. Now remember, you’re not trying to erase your flaws, the foundation is purely to even out your skin tone. However, if you do have a stubborn problem area, add a tiny bit of concealer. Next step is to set your foundation (and concealer) with a little bit of powder. Don’t use too much of it, because your skin will look too matt and not natural. If you like the dewy look, skip the powder.

2.Enhanced eyebrows
A lot of ladies out there neglect their eyebrows, which is really a shame because brows really do frame your face. Make sure you don’t over pluck your eyebrows, because thin brows will give an older and much harsher look. After giving your brows the right shape, it’s time to fill them in with a shadow or pencil. Don’t draw them on, keep a light hand. After filling them in, brush them out with an eyebrow brush to get rid of all the excess powder/pencil.

3.Defined eyes
You don’t need any crazy colors, try to go for natural ones like brown or grey. You can also use black, but this can be a bit too harsh. Taking any type of eyeliner of your choice (pencil, liquid or gel eyeliner), start tight lining your upper lash line.  Tight lining means coloring between your lashes, instead of on top of your lash line. This will give an illusion of thicker lashes. After that you can also line your upper lash line regularly. The trick here is to not apply anything on your lower lash line, as this can drag your eyes down. With the help of an eyelash curler, curl your lashes and apply mascara. Don’t overdo it with the mascara, one – two coats is enough.

4.Rosy lips
All you have to do now is to get the soft rosy lips. First of all, it’s important to moisturize your lips with a nice lip balm or lip conditioner. Personally I  just like to use a bit of balm, so my lips won’t look chapped. If you have really pale lips, and you want to add some color, take a nice pinky lip stain or stick and apply this lightly on your lips. If you have more pigmented lips, try to look for a color that looks like your lips, but better.
